== Members == IAFME is comprised of may different [[:Category:Patient groups|patient organisations]] from multiple countries. It includes [[Emerge Australia]], [[Japan ME Association]], [[ME CFS Foundation South Africa]], [[The American ME and CFS Society]], United States, [[Forward-ME]] (a collective of British ME organizations led by the [[Margaret of Mar, 31st Countess of Mar|Countess of Mar]]) and two Spanish organizations: [[Sensibilització Central]] and [[Plataforma Familiars Fm-SFC-SQM]]. The actions and letters of IAFME are supported by many more ME patient organizations and advocates.<ref name=":1">{{Cite web | url = https://ammes.org/2018/05/17/may-12-letter-to-the-world-health-organization/ | title = May 12 Letter to the World Health Organization – American ME and CFS Society|language=en-US|access-date=2018-12-06}}</ref> * The Chair of the IAFME is the Chief Executive of [[Action for ME|Action for M.E.]], [[Sonya Chowdhury]], while Dr [[Heidi Nicholl]], CEO of Emerge Australia, acts as Vice Chair. * Executive Director of IAFME is [[Alexandra Heumber]] a former international advocate for Médecins Sans Frontières and Head of Policy for the [[Drugs for Neglected Diseases Initiative|Drugs for Neglected Diseases initiative]].<ref name=":0" />
